About The Position

Reporting to the Director of Fixed Asset Strategy, the strategic Fixed Asset Coordinator is responsible for planning, coordinating, and deploying company-owned propane assets. This role will support capital allocation efforts, drive redeployment strategies, and ensure assets are strategically positioned to meet customer demand while maximizing ROI and minimizing capital expenditures

Responsibilities

  • Assist with strategic development plans for tanks and related assets to support growth and reduce inventory
  • Coordinate re-allocation of assets to optimize/mitigate capital spend through refurbishment and internal tank transfers.
  • Coordinate the reallocation of pump stations, cages, cylinders, and other assets with field operations and third-party vendors
  • Coordinate the deployment and pickup of company-owned tanks with third-party refurbishment vendors
  • Coordinate the transfer and pickup of tanks and other assets with field operations
  • Assist with establishing and managing HUB internal locations
  • Collaborate with logistics and field operations to streamline workflows
  • Maintain detailed records of company-owned tanks, monitors, and other related assets
  • Assist with asset utilization projects
